What Counts as a Plumbing Emergency?
It’s important to know the difference between a minor issue and a true emergency. Some plumbing problems can wait, but others need immediate attention to prevent serious damage.
Urgent Plumbing Situations
Burst Pipes and Major Leaks
These are the most common causes of a pipe leak emergency. A burst pipe can release litres of water in minutes.
Blocked Drains Causing Overflow
Severely blocked drains can lead to wastewater backing up into sinks, toilets, or outdoor areas. Professional services like high-pressure water jetting and CCTV drain inspections are often needed to fix these issues properly.
Gas Leaks
Gas leaks are extremely dangerous and require immediate professional gas leak detection and repair.
Hot Water System Failures
Losing hot water may not seem urgent, but in homes, businesses, or industrial sites, it can disrupt daily operations. Emergency repairs or replacements for gas, electric, or solar systems may be necessary.
Overflowing Toilets or Sewer Backups
These can pose serious health risks and should be addressed immediately.

How to Handle a Pipe Leak Emergency
If a leak happens, act quickly:
Turn off your main water supply
Switch off electricity if water is near outlets
Contain the leak with buckets or towels
Call your emergency plumber immediately
Quick action can significantly reduce damage.
Common Causes of Pipe Leak Emergencies
Understanding causes helps with prevention:
Ageing or corroded pipes
High water pressure
Blocked drains
Tree root intrusion
Poor installation
Ground movement
Regular maintenance can reduce these risks.
Preventing Plumbing Emergencies
Simple steps can make a big difference:
Schedule regular inspections
Fix small leaks early
Avoid flushing inappropriate items
Maintain your hot water system
Install proper drainage solutions
Prevention saves money and stress.
